Interpretation

What this quote means

Life is an experience that should be lived fully and passionately, as there are no second chances.

This quote by Charlie Chaplin emphasizes the importance of living life to the fullest, encouraging us to embrace all of our emotions and experiences. It expresses the idea that life is fleeting and unpredictable, akin to a play where there is no opportunity for rehearsal; therefore, we should cherish every moment and make the most of our time before it comes to an end without recognition.
